Latest Patents

Janello holds a patent for a unique invention titled "Tire Inside Noise Absorber." This invention features a sound absorber designed for insertion into pneumatic tires. It consists of a support strip attached to the rim of the wheel, along with a network of flexible fibers that extend radially from the mounting strip. This innovative design aims to minimize internal noise within tires, providing a quieter driving experience.
